An offset may be entered as a value with 4 digits after the decimal point. This allows offset entry of
values as small as ±0.0001 inHg.
Note: There are no offsets for the 0.0000 inHg and 30.0000 inHg points for the Pt output. Also, there
are no offsets for the 1.6000 inHg and 38.000 inHg points for the Ps1 and Ps2 output.
Note: When offset values are entered, they are actually added to the existing offset value already
resident in the 6600-NG.
Verification Procedure
1.
Generate the pressures shown in the Verification points table for a specific point.
2.
Only for point 1, wait at least 5 minutes to allow temperature effects to stabilize. For other points,
wait at least 1 minute.
3.
If an offset needs to be entered for the point, enter it through the RS232 port.
4.
Note the Actual values (after the offset has been entered), for Pt, Ps2 and Ps1, on the calibration
report.
5.
Repeat steps 1 through 4 for all the 21 points in the table.
6.
The verification process is complete.
7.
If you wish to record the offsets stored in the 6600-NG (recommended), then through the RS232
port, send the ‘SO=0’ command to see all the Ps1 offsets, the ‘SO=1’ command to see all the Pt
offsets and command ‘SO=2’ for all the Ps2 offsets. The offsets will be displayed in 5%
increments. Although the offsets for the 5% points are never entered, these values are
interpolated based on the 10% offset values. Please bear in mind that the offsets displayed may
not match what you entered in step 3 above. This is because the entered value is added to the
existing value already stored in the 6600-NG.
